
The annual cross country motorycle ride called Run for the Wall will make a stop in Junction City late Sunday afternoon. Riders are expected to leave I-70 and roll up North Washington Sreet to Heritage Park where there will be a ceremony to welcome the riders who are traveling from Ontario, CA to Washington DC to a final stop at the Vietnam Veterans Memorial.
This event that draws riders from across the country has been in existencce for 34 years. It was originally started to raise awareness about POW's, KIA's and MIA's. In Junction City the ride coordinator, David Eckel, noted that about 300 to 400 riders will travel up Washington Street through an avenue of 300 flags held by volunteers.
State Representative Nate Butler will serve as the keynote speaker during a ceremony in front of the Kansas Vietnam Veterans Memorial. That will be followed by a wreath laying ceremony.
Riders will then travel to the Eagles for dinner and then spend the night in Junction City. Early the next morning they will be fed breakfast before departing eastward on their trip.
